Transaction 3043335bf937798ef8042fa2d758941895e2594238695e45a433b0094e7de300
1 Input
2 Outputs
- 3043335bf937798ef8042fa2d758941895e2594238695e45a433b0094e7de300:0
- 3043335bf937798ef8042fa2d758941895e2594238695e45a433b0094e7de300:1
value 393889
address 3JkyLRhYEAVNzUYSTvK6fJf2sbq7NE47eV
value 4929050
address 1BaJ72NiUjuRi7MozYcJKVyQt349HwWek9